in a large plastic bag, mix all the marinade ingredients (everything except the chicken) together. place the chicken in the bag and mush the marinade around to cover the chicken. place in fridge for at least 4 hours to overnight. flip bag over every couple hours. preheat oven to 375 degrees f. place chicken legs on a aluminum foil baking sheet. pour marinade over the chicken. place in oven for 15 minutes. remove chicken and preheat broiler. with a turkey baster or spoon, spoon sauce from baking sheet over chicken legs evenly. place chicken back into the oven under the broiler for 10 minutes.
